Lighting Replacement in Kansas City, KS
Lighting replacement services involve upgrading or swapping out existing light fixtures to improve the appearance, functionality, or energy efficiency of a property. These projects can include replacing outdated or damaged ceiling lights, wall sconces, outdoor fixtures, or decorative lighting in various areas such as kitchens, living rooms, patios, and entryways. Homeowners often seek these services when upgrading their interior design, addressing safety concerns, or improving outdoor illumination to enhance curb appeal and security.
Before requesting lighting replacement, property owners typically want to understand the scope of the project, including the types of fixtures available, compatibility with existing electrical systems, and any necessary modifications. It’s also important to consider the placement of new fixtures, the desired lighting style, and whether additional features such as dimmer switches or smart controls are desired. Clarifying these details helps ensure the replacement aligns with the overall aesthetic and functional goals for the space.

Lighting Replacement Questions
What types of lighting can be replaced? Various fixtures including indoor ceiling lights, outdoor security lights, and decorative fixtures can be replaced or upgraded.
Why should lighting be replaced? Replacing outdated or malfunctioning lighting improves energy efficiency, enhances safety, and updates the appearance of a property.
Are there options for energy-efficient lighting? Yes, LED fixtures and other energy-saving options are available to reduce electricity use and maintenance needs.
Is professional assistance needed for lighting replacement? Yes, proper installation ensures safety, compliance, and optimal performance of the new lighting fixtures.
